BS490 Doctorate Dissertation

 


Credit:

6 Semester Hours

Required Materials:

None

Description:

You must work closely with your mentor in developing your dissertation topic and in working through the dissertation.

GUIDE & FORMATTING:

1) Your dissertation should be no less than 150 pages, 1 inch margins, 12 point type, Times Roman Font, double spaced.

2) Your dissertation should be free of grammatical and syntax errors and should represent the caliber of work you have completed during your Doctoral Program.

3) Your dissertation should be consecutively numbered, with table of contents and apendixes if necessary. Your dissertation should be divided up into relevant chapters with sub-section headings within each chapter. You will need to also include a list of tables, figures and illustrations that are included.

4) You dissertation must include a full bibliography and the material should use a consistant citing system.
